Mushroom Tofu Stir Fry has become a staple in my kitchen, especially on busy weeknights. This dish is not only quick to prepare, taking just 25 minutes, but it is also a vibrant mix of flavors and textures. With the earthy taste of mushrooms and the protein-packed goodness of tofu, it’s perfect for anyone looking for a healthy meal that doesn’t compromise on taste. Let’s dive into making this delightful stir-fry!
Why You’ll Love This Mushroom Tofu Stir Fry
This Mushroom Tofu Stir Fry is a culinary gem that offers numerous benefits:
- Quick and easy to prepare, perfect for weeknight dinners.
- Healthy and nutritious, making it a great option for a vegan diet.
- Packed with protein from tofu and fiber from vegetables.
- Customizable with your favorite veggies, making it versatile.
- Low in calories but high in flavor, ideal for weight management.
- Easy cleanup with just one pan required, great for busy cooks.
With its Asian influence and vibrant ingredients, it’s no wonder why this dish is a family favorite!
Ingredients for Mushroom Tofu Stir Fry
Gather these items:
- 1 block Firm Tofu (Press to remove excess water)
- 200 grams Mixed Mushrooms (Use varieties like cremini, shiitake, or oyster)
- 1 cup Broccoli Florets (Can swap with snap peas or bok choy)
- 1 cup Bell Peppers (Any variety works)
- 2 tablespoons Vegetable Oil (Use peanut or sesame oil for added flavor)
- 3 cloves Garlic (Minced)
- 3 tablespoons Soy Sauce (Use tamari for gluten-free)
- 1 inch Ginger (Freshly grated is best)
- 1/2 teaspoon Black Pepper (Add pepper flakes for heat)
- 1/2 cup Vegetable Broth (Substitute with water if unavailable)
- 1 tablespoon Cornstarch (Mix with water to create a slurry)
How to Make Mushroom Tofu Stir Fry Step-by-Step
- Step 1: Prepare Tofu: Press the firm tofu to remove excess moisture, then cut it into cubes.
- Step 2: Sauté Tofu: Heat vegetable oil in a large pan over medium-high heat. Add the tofu and cook for about 5 minutes until golden brown.
- Step 3: Cook Aromatics: In the same pan, add minced garlic and grated ginger. Sauté for around 30 seconds until fragrant.
- Step 4: Add Vegetables: Stir in sliced mixed mushrooms, broccoli florets, and bell peppers. Fry for 5-7 minutes until tender-crisp.
- Step 5: Combine: Return the crispy tofu to the pan. Pour in soy sauce, black pepper, and vegetable broth; stir until combined.
- Step 6: Thicken Sauce: Mix cornstarch slurry with a little water and incorporate into the pan. Cook for 2-3 minutes until thickened.
- Step 7: Serve: Enjoy your hot Mushroom and Tofu Stir Fry over rice or noodles.
Pro Tips for the Best Mushroom Tofu Stir Fry
Keep these in mind to enhance your dish:
- Ensure tofu is pressed well to achieve a crispy texture.
- Use a mix of mushrooms for varied flavor and texture.
- For a spicy kick, add chili flakes or fresh sliced chilies.
- Cook on high heat to achieve that perfect stir-fried finish.
Best Ways to Serve Mushroom Tofu Stir Fry
Here are some serving ideas:
- Serve over steamed jasmine rice for a filling meal.
- Pair it with quinoa for a protein-packed option.
- Top with sesame seeds and fresh herbs for an extra flavor boost.
How to Store and Reheat Mushroom Tofu Stir Fry
To store, place leftovers in an airtight container in the fridge for up to three days. Reheat in a skillet over medium heat until warmed through, making it a fantastic meal prep option.
Frequently Asked Questions About Mushroom Tofu Stir Fry
What is Mushroom Tofu Stir Fry?
This dish is a delicious combination of sautéed mushrooms and crispy tofu, seasoned with soy sauce and fresh vegetables, making it ideal for anyone seeking a healthy Mushroom Tofu Stir Fry recipe.
Can I make Mushroom Tofu Stir Fry ahead of time?
Yes, you can prepare the ingredients in advance and quickly sauté them when ready to eat. This makes it an excellent option for busy weeknights.
How do I avoid common mistakes with Mushroom Tofu Stir Fry?
To avoid mushy vegetables, ensure you cook them just until tender-crisp and do not overcrowd the pan, allowing for even cooking.
Variations of Mushroom Tofu Stir Fry You Can Try
Feel free to experiment with these variations:
- Substitute tofu with tempeh for a different texture.
- Add cashews or peanuts for crunch and additional protein.
- Incorporate different vegetables like carrots or snap peas for variety.

For more delicious recipes, check out our Vegetable Mei Fun Recipe or try our Black Pepper Chicken with Mushrooms.

For more information on the health benefits of mushrooms, visit Healthline.
Print
Quick and Easy Mushroom Tofu Stir Fry Recipe
- Total Time: 25 minutes
- Yield: 4 servings 1x
- Diet: Vegan
Description
Enjoy this Mushroom and Tofu Stir-Fry, a quick and healthy meal packed with flavor and nutrition.
Ingredients
- 1 block Firm Tofu (Press to remove excess water)
- 200 grams Mixed Mushrooms (Use varieties like cremini, shiitake, or oyster)
- 1 cup Broccoli Florets (Can swap with snap peas or bok choy)
- 1 cup Bell Peppers (Any variety works)
- 2 tablespoons Vegetable Oil (Use peanut or sesame oil for added flavor)
- 3 cloves Garlic (Minced)
- 3 tablespoons Soy Sauce (Use tamari for gluten-free)
- 1 inch Ginger (Freshly grated is best)
- 1/2 teaspoon Black Pepper (Add pepper flakes for heat)
- 1/2 cup Vegetable Broth (Substitute with water if unavailable)
- 1 tablespoon Cornstarch (Mix with water to create a slurry)
Instructions
- Prepare Tofu: Press the firm tofu to remove excess moisture, then cut it into cubes.
- Sauté Tofu: Heat vegetable oil in a large pan over medium-high heat. Add the tofu and cook for about 5 minutes until golden brown.
- Cook Aromatics: In the same pan, add minced garlic and grated ginger. Sauté for around 30 seconds until fragrant.
- Add Vegetables: Stir in sliced mixed mushrooms, broccoli florets, and bell peppers. Fry for 5-7 minutes until tender-crisp.
- Combine: Return the crispy tofu to the pan. Pour in soy sauce, black pepper, and vegetable broth; stir until combined.
- Thicken Sauce: Mix cornstarch slurry with a little water and incorporate into the pan. Cook for 2-3 minutes until thickened.
- Serve: Enjoy your hot Mushroom and Tofu Stir-Fry over rice or noodles.
Notes
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Category: Main Course
- Method: Stir Fry
- Cuisine: Asian
Nutrition
- Serving Size: 1 serving
- Calories: 300
- Sugar: 3 g
- Sodium: 600 mg
- Fat: 18 g
- Saturated Fat: 3 g
- Unsaturated Fat: 15 g
- Trans Fat: 0 g
- Carbohydrates: 20 g
- Fiber: 5 g
- Protein: 15 g
- Cholesterol: 0 mg
